    • A traction overshoe which enables a user to safely cover the footwear while sitting or standing. The traction overshoe has left side flaps, right side flaps and a tension cord system. The left side flaps and the right side flaps are contiguous with the front and back supports of the traction overshoe and a tension cord system is attached to the right side flaps and the left side flaps. In use, a user grips a bottom grip-bar and moves the left side flaps and the right side flaps into vertical positions. The user then slips the footwear into the device and moves the bottom grip-bar in an upward position to secure the left side flaps and the right side flaps against the footwear.

    • A non-cleated, soft metal traction device reduces or eliminates slippage on wet and hard surfaces, such as mossy rocks beneath the water surface of a body of water. The traction device includes at least one external metal shank, plate or bar attachable to a footwear item with a desired binding system. The shank is preferably made from a soft metal material, such as a non-heat-treated aluminum alloy, so it is soft enough to grip and elastically conform to moist, wet or otherwise slippery rock and shale. The contact surface of the shank may include grooves, ribs, spaced apart ridges, or other small surface variations to improve the traction of the device in transition environments.
